Book of Night

By: Holly Black

Release Date | May 3

Genre | Fantasy

Reality can be altered with shadows. Your appearance can be enhanced, power increased, used for entertainment but manipulation has a price - time. Each alteration shaves a moment of time from your life, from minutes to days, the time is forever gone.

Charlie Hall lives in this reality, working as a low-level con artist and bartender as she avoids the underground world of shadow training. She survives with odd jobs and naive new customers but when a figure from her past returns, her life is thrown into chaos and her future is unclear, and at worst - nonexistent. With no other choice, Charlie thrusts herself into the world of magic, determined to control the shadows and survive the dangerous underground.

Burn Down, Rise Up

By: Vincent Tirado

Release Date | May 3

Genre | Young Adult

Disappearances in the Bronx have risen in the last year and nobody knows why. Sixteen-year-old Raquel ignores the statistics, the police only search for the missing white kids, but when her crush Charlize's cousin disappears, Raquel begins to pay attention. And when her mother contracts an illness which to her, seems linked to the disappearances, her concern only heightens.

Raquel and Charlize decide to investigate and find the missing cousin but together they soon realise that the disappearances are connected and linked to the urban legend called the Echo Game. A game rumoured to trap people in a sinister world underneath New York and to survive the underground world, each individual must follow the world's rules based on a dark chapter of the state's history. If Raquel and Charlize want to save everything and everyone they love, they need to win the game - or die trying.

The Hacienda

By: Isabel Cañas

Release Date | May 3

Genre | Horror

With the turmoil surrounding her father's execution, destruction of home, and upheaval of the Mexican government, Beatriz craves safety. It is why when Don Rodolfo Solórzano proposes, she eagerly accepts ignoring the rumours surrounding his first wife and instead focusing on the prospect of finally having her own home and the security that comes with it again.

Her new home is not what she imagined. There are invisible eyes that watch, visions and voices that haunt her sleep, a sister-in-law who mocks her fears but who won't enter the house at night, and a cook who burns incense constantly. All these quirks are starting to make her wonder, what happened to the first wife?

The only things Beatriz knows for certain is something's undoubtedly wrong with her new home and that nobody here will help her. Desperate, she latches onto the young priest, Padres Andrés, as an ally and confidant. Andrés is not an ordinary priest and with his skills in witchcraft, has the capability to ward away the presence she believes is haunting the home but, even Padres Andrés may not be strong enough to banish the darkness.

Trust

By: Hernan Diaz

Release Date | May 3

Genre | Historical Fiction

Everyone in New York knows of Benjamin and Helen Rask. He, a legendary tycoon and her, a brilliant daughter of aristocrats who together, hold court over the wealth and affluence in New York. There are whispers to how they obtained their status with financial plays and reclusiveness at the forefront of theories, but how did they acquire their immense fortune and what does it mean within the confines of the 1920s?

Child Zero

By: Chris Holm

Release Date | May 10

Genre | Science Fiction

It started four years ago, a rise in bacterial infections that spread aggressively and proved immune to all medicinal attempts. Public health officials dismissed the uptick of each new infection as coincidence - they were wrong. Soon antibiotic resistance surged and diseases long thought controlled came back with a vengeance and the death toll, it too surged. And in the midst of the chaos, New York suffers a bioterror attack, the worst the world has ever seen, organised by a new wave of extremists determined to bring humanity to the brink of extinction.

Detective Jacob Gibson is currently home caring for his ill daughter when a call from his partner asking for assistance has him standing in Central Park, the newest site of mass murder. But despite the squalor and filth surrounding the bodies, the victims died in perfect health. What's worse is that his only chance for answers is somebody on the run from dangerous men, an 11-year-old boy, to be exact.

Dead End Girls

By: Wendy Heard

Release Date | May 10

Genre | Thriller

In one week, Maude will be dead. Well, for everyone but herself. After years of meticulous planning, her plan has come to fruition and she knows exactly when, where, how, and who will help her die. The why though, Maude has yet to figure that out.

Her parents definitely deserve it and the call to freedom beckons her, all she has to do to gain that freedom is die except, her plan goes awry when her step-cousin Frankie, someone she barely knows, discovers her plan. Maude is terrified of the repercussions she’ll face having been found out but Frankie doesn’t want to snitch, she wants in. With two girls catapulted into a new unknown, they will risk all they have for freedom, but what if the poison that caused them to die joined them?

Siren Queen

By: Nghi Vo

Release Date | May 10

Genre | Historical Fiction

Siren Queen by Nghi Vo combines fantasy and historical fiction to follow Luli Wei and her journey towards becoming a star in Hollywood despite the limited opportunities presented to her as a Chinese American. Luli doesn’t care - she’d rather play a monster than a maid.

What Luli doesn’t realise is that the worst monsters in Hollywood aren’t on the ones on screen. The studio wants to own Luli and for any part of her to be owned, a bargain must be made in magic and blood. Unfair bargains that are made by those like Luli, those who will do anything it takes to achieve their dreams. Luli is determined to become a star even if it means transforming from playing monster into being one.

This Time Tomorrow

By: Emma Straub

Release Date | May 17

Genre | Science Fiction

As Alice contemplates her life on the eve of her 40th, she recognises the past 40 years have been nothing flash but overall, she's content. She enjoys her work, her independence, her lifelong best friend, and her romantic status but her father is fading and it still seems like something is missing.

When Alice wakes up the next morning, she is prepared to celebrate her 40th but instead finds herself transported back to 1996, the day of her 16th birthday. It isn't the travelling back in time that shocks her, it's her dad - alive and the dad she remembered growing up with. Armed with a new perspective on life and memories of her past but also future, is there anything she would change?

The Favor

By: Nora Murphy

Release Date | May 31

Genre | Thriller

Leah and McKenna live parallel lives, but they've never met. They never accidentally crossed paths at the gym or boarded the same train. They never discussed their personal problems. They never acknowledged the other despite their similarities of success, wealth, happiness, and entrapment.

That's because they both know what it means to live inside a home more dangerous than the outside. Driving past McKenna's one night, Leah sees a reflection of her own home life through the front door - the perfect husband whose anything but. Instead of driving away and forgetting what she saw, Leah makes the decision to watch out for her from afar until one night, she intervenes. They may not know each other, but they will.

Yerba Buena

By: Nina LaCour

Release Date | May 31

Genre | Fiction

Nina LaCour, author of Watch Over Me, is releasing her first official full-length novel with Yerba Buena and I am excited. Even though this is a romance, I am still going to read it because I appreciate the uniqueness of the author's writing and anticipate beautiful imagery in this work.

Running away from home at sixteen leaves Sara Foster lost but not for long. Leaving behind her pain and naivety, Sara transformed herself over the years into a top-end bartender coveted for her cocktail ability and the mystery that surrounds her.

Emilie Dubois is letting life pass her by. In her seventh year and fifth major change as an undergraduate - she wants the beauty and community her grandparents cultivated but cannot commit to one thing. On a whim, Emilie takes a floral arrangement position at the glamorous Yerba Buena restaurant soon embarking on a new stage in life and also a relationship with the married owner.

When Sara catches sight of Emilie at Yerba Buena, their connection is instant but the damage carried by both through their choices tears their connection apart over and over and when Sara's past catches up and Emilie finally gains a sense of purpose, together they must decide if their love is more powerful than their past.
